Working people across the United States have stepped up to help out our friends, neighbors and communities during these trying times. In our regular Service + Solidarity Spotlight series, we’ll showcase one of these stories every day. Here’s today’s story.

The Texas AFL-CIO has posted a list of resources for union members, retirees and allies looking to help the Uvalde, Texas, community in the aftermath of Tuesday’s devastating mass shooting at Robb Elementary School that killed 19 children and two teachers. Affiliated unions are working with the state federation to assist in the labor movement’s response, especially after the crowds that have descended on Uvalde dissipate. If you are wondering how you can help, this developing resource page will get you started.
